Why Is My Android Phone Overheating?

Common causes include:

  • Gaming or demanding apps
  • Charging while using the phone
  • Background applications
  • Poor mobile signal
  • High screen brightness
  • Outdated Android software
  • Battery degradation
  • Hot weather

Identifying the cause helps you apply the correct solution.

Fix 1: Close Background Apps

Apps running in the background continue using your processor and battery.

Open the recent apps screen and close applications you’re not using. Also check Settings > Battery to identify apps consuming excessive power.

Fix 2: Stop Using the Phone While Charging

Using your phone during charging increases heat generation because the processor and battery are working simultaneously.

Allow your phone to charge without gaming, streaming, or video calling whenever possible.

Fix 3: Remove the Protective Case

Some thick protective cases trap heat during charging or heavy usage.

Remove the case temporarily and check whether your phone cools down more quickly.

Fix 4: Lower Screen Brightness

A bright display consumes more power and produces additional heat.

Enable Adaptive Brightness or manually reduce screen brightness, especially when indoors.

Fix 5: Turn Off Unused Features

Wireless features consume battery even when you’re not actively using them.

Disable features such as:

  • Bluetooth
  • GPS
  • Mobile Hotspot
  • NFC
  • Wi-Fi (when not needed)

This reduces processor activity and helps lower your phone’s temperature.

Fix 6: Update Android

Software updates often include battery optimizations and thermal management improvements.

To check for updates:

  1. Open Settings.
  2. Tap Software Update or System Update.
  3. Download and install any available updates.
  4. Restart your phone.

Keeping Android updated helps prevent overheating caused by software bugs.

Fix 7: Check for Battery-Hungry Apps

Some apps continue running in the background even after you close them, consuming excessive CPU power and generating heat.

To identify these apps:

  1. Open Settings.
  2. Go to Battery or Battery & Device Care.
  3. Tap Battery Usage.
  4. Review which apps are using the most power.

If an app is using an unusually high amount of battery, update it, restrict its background activity, or uninstall it if you no longer need it.

Fix 8: Charge with the Original Charger

Using low-quality or incompatible chargers can generate excess heat and reduce charging efficiency.

Whenever possible, use the original charger supplied by your phone manufacturer or a certified replacement that supports your device’s recommended charging standard.

Avoid cheap chargers that don’t meet safety standards.

Fix 9: Turn On Battery Saver Mode

Battery Saver reduces background activity, limits processor usage, and lowers power consumption.

To enable it:

  1. Open Settings.
  2. Go to Battery.
  3. Turn on Battery Saver or Power Saving Mode.

This can significantly reduce heat, especially if your battery is already running low.

Fix 10: Avoid Direct Sunlight

High environmental temperatures make it harder for your phone to cool itself.

If your phone overheats:

  • Move it into the shade.
  • Keep it away from hot car dashboards.
  • Avoid leaving it on blankets or pillows while charging.
  • Use it in a cool, ventilated environment whenever possible.

Never place an overheating phone in a refrigerator or freezer, as rapid temperature changes can cause condensation and damage internal components.

Fix 11: Reset App Preferences or Factory Reset

If overheating started after installing a particular app or changing system settings, resetting app preferences may help.

If software corruption is suspected and none of the previous fixes work:

  1. Back up your important data.
  2. Perform a Factory Reset from Settings > System > Reset Options.

Only use this step after exhausting all other software troubleshooting methods.

Fix 12: Replace the Battery or Seek Professional Repair

If your phone continues overheating even while idle, the battery may have degraded or developed an internal fault.

Signs that indicate a hardware issue include:

  • Phone overheating without heavy use.
  • Battery swelling.
  • Random shutdowns.
  • Rapid battery drain.
  • Charging problems even after trying different chargers.

If you notice any of these symptoms, stop using the device and contact an authorized service center. A swollen battery should be replaced immediately for safety reasons.

Additional Tips

Keep Apps Updated

Developers frequently release updates that improve battery efficiency and fix bugs that may cause excessive CPU usage.

Update your apps regularly through the Google Play Store.

Limit High-Performance Activities

Gaming, video editing, 4K recording, and long video calls place heavy demands on your phone’s processor.

Take short breaks during extended sessions to allow your device to cool naturally.

Remove Unused Widgets

Widgets refresh data in the background, which can increase battery consumption and contribute to higher temperatures.

Keep only the widgets you regularly use.

Common Mistakes to Avoid

Avoid these common mistakes when dealing with an overheating Android phone:

  • Continuing to charge the phone while it’s already overheating.
  • Using counterfeit or low-quality chargers.
  • Running demanding games while charging.
  • Covering the phone with blankets or pillows.
  • Cooling the phone rapidly using ice, refrigerators, or freezers.

Following the fixes one at a time makes it easier to identify the actual cause.

Frequently Asked Questions

Why is my Android phone overheating even when I’m not using it?

This is usually caused by background apps, poor mobile signal, malware, software bugs, or a failing battery.

Is it normal for a phone to get warm while charging?

Yes. A slight increase in temperature is normal during charging. However, if the phone becomes too hot to comfortably hold or displays a temperature warning, stop charging and investigate the cause.

Can overheating damage my Android phone?

Yes. Repeated overheating can shorten battery lifespan, reduce performance, and potentially damage internal components over time.

Should I remove my phone case if it overheats?

Yes. Thick protective cases can trap heat. Removing the case while charging or during heavy use may improve heat dissipation.

When should I replace my phone battery?

If your battery drains quickly, swells, overheats regularly, or causes unexpected shutdowns, it should be inspected and replaced by an authorized repair center.
